_The same. Herodias_. [_Enters from centre._]

Maecha. Mistress, thy mother!

THE THREE MAIDENS

[_Withdraw quickly from the window._]

Herodias. What are ye doing here, damsels? Salome thou! Shall we let it be said that we have brought evil manners into Jerusalem?

Salome. [_Intending to wound, but outwardly meek._] Methinks it is said already.

Herodias. [_Enraged._] Go!

Salome. Yes, mother. [_She crosses over, and lingers between the pillars of the balcony._]

Herodias. Ye damsels, stay! Ye are Judeans?

Maecha. Yes, mistress.

Herodias. Intelligence hath reached me of one they call the Baptist stirring up rebellion in the streets. Which of you know the man?

Maecha. She does.

Abi. She hath this moment confessed it.

Herodias. What dost thou know of him?

Miriam. That last night I sat at his feet praying.

Salome. [_Coming forward_] Thou? Thou?

Maecha. Pardon! A moment ago he was standing close to the Palace.

Herodias. Show him to me.

Maecha. [_From the window_] Now is he gone.

Herodias. [_To Miriam_] So speed after him, and when thou hast found him, bring him privately through yonder gate. [_Points below to the right_]

Salome. She shall not.... I will not ... _Not_ her!

Herodias. Why not?

Salome. [_Throwing her arms round Miriam_] She is dearest to me. I will not let her go out of my sight. [_Comes over and supplicates Herodias_] Mother!

Herodias. Art thou still such a child? [_To Miriam._] Go!

Salome. [_Angrily._] Miriam!

[_Exit Miriam._

Herodias. Such a child, and already hast the tooth of a serpent in thy mouth!

Salome. [_Kneels on the couch before her mother and encircles her knees with her arms._] Forgive me, mother. We, thou and I, are not like others. We sting those we love.

Herodias. [_Sotto voce._] And those we hate?

Salome. [_Sotto voce._] We kiss!

Herodias. [_Laughing._] Child! [_She kisses her._]

Salome. [_Laughing._] Thou kissest me!
